History of Diamonds - Blood, Monopoly, and the Ring on Your Finger
De Beers built a diamond monopoly and convinced the world diamonds were rare. This diamond history documentary covers the Kimberley diamond rush, Cecil Rhodes and De Beers, the invention of the diamond engagement ring tradition and "A Diamond Is Forever" campaign, blood diamonds and conflict diamonds in Sierra Leone and Angola, the Kimberley Process, De Beers' price-fixing scandal, and the rise of lab-grown diamonds now collapsing the century-old monopoly. Diamonds aren't actually rare — they're common geologically. The scarcity was manufactured after Rhodes consolidated the Kimberley diamond fields in 1888, giving one company control of up to 90% of world supply.
